1972 Wimbledon Championships – Men's doubles
Roy Emerson and Rod Laver were prevented from defending their title due to the International Lawn Tennis Federation ban on World Championship Tennis contract players competing in their tournaments.

Bob Hewitt and Frew McMillan defeated Stan Smith and Erik van Dillen in the final, 6–2, 6–2, 9–7 to win the gentlemen's doubles title at the 1972 Wimbledon Championships.
